## Formula sandbox tuning

User-supplied formulas in Gridmoor execute inside a restricted interpreter with hard ceilings on time, memory, and call depth. Reviewers should confirm any change to these ceilings is justified in the PR description, since raising them widens the abuse surface. Defaults were chosen from production traces. The current limits are as follows.

limits module of tafog-fawip:
WEIGHTS = {
    "julix": 57,
    "lamys": 992,
    "kasvan": 209,
    "quenok": 750,
    "alddor": 259,
    "oliath": 1009,
    "wenix": 815,
}

**Q: Why does the Harrowgate service open its own pool instead of using pgBridle?**

A: Legacy. Reject PRs that add direct pools; everything should route through pgBridle with max 20 connections per replica. Watch for reviewers missing idle-timeout overrides — anything above 300s breaks the Stanmoor failover. Pool metrics live in the Larkfield dashboard. To run the pool audit tool locally you must first unseal its config store; when the tool prompts during setup, enter the recovery passphrase shown directly below.

unlock words, tawif-tahop: oliys-ulawyn-tamdor-lamys-casox-jormir-fraius-kasath-ulador-ulamir-holir-sorys-holeth

Subject: Key rotation — tailgrep CLI

The service key used by tailgrep, our internal log-tailing CLI, rotates this Thursday at 10:00. The old key stops working immediately after. Release pipelines that shell out to tailgrep must be updated before the 4.2 cut, or log verification steps will fail. Scopes are unchanged: logs:read on all non-prod streams. The new key is below.

gateway credential: kto3_qfe